FISHING NEWS

COWELL
Jetty is fishing has been exceptionally quiet except for a few crabs. Boats are doing very well on snapper.
Silvers are on most local beaches.

PORT NEILL
Once again snapper fishing has been very good both for boaties inshore and offshore; snapper have also come from the rocks south of the town.
Most beaches have a few silvers or yellow fin whiting and the jetty has squid and tommies.

TUMBY BAY
The hospital grounds are definitely worth a try for some King George whiting, and out at the Group whiting have been harder to find in numbers but there are medium size snook, tommies and red mullet to top up the catch.
Tumby jetty has been very quiet with tommies scarce and only a few snook around.
In the marina mullet are there on day and absent the next.
At second creek, salmon trout is basically the sole catch and in Peake Bay there are a few flathead and whiting plus good numbers of trevally.
